DNA test kits are kits that allow individuals to collect and test a sample of their DNA, usually from saliva or cheek cells, to learn more about their genetic makeup. These kits can be used for a variety of purposes, such as determining ancestry, identifying potential health risks, or even solving crimes. Some DNA test kits can be used at home, while others require a healthcare professional to administer the test. However, the results of DNA test kits should be interpreted with caution, as they may not always be accurate or complete.
The process of using a DNA test kit is relatively simple. Typically, an individual purchases the kit online or in a store, receives it by mail, and provides a saliva sample by spitting into a tube. The sample is then shipped back to the company, where it undergoes several tests to analyze the DNA. Once the testing is complete, the individual receives a report detailing their genetic makeup. This report may include information about their ancestry, such as ethnic background and geographic origins. It can also provide insights into health risks, including the likelihood of developing certain diseases or conditions. Additionally, DNA test kits can reveal information about physical traits, such as eye color, hair color, and height.

Recent developments by key players in the DNA Test Kits Market:
23andMe, Inc
- Bankruptcy and Ownership Change: In March 2025, 23andMe fil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y due to declining sales of their kits and a data breach that occurred in 2023. Co-founder Anne Wojcicki resigned, and Joe Selsavage was appointed as the interim CEO.
- Acquisition: The company was initially acquired by Regeneron for $256 million in May 2025. However, it was later outbid by Anne’s nonprofit, the TTAM Research Institute, for $305 million, pending final court approval.
- Privacy and Security: In June 2025, British regulators imposed a fine of £2.31 million on the company due to the 2023 data breach. Since then, stricter authentication protocols, including two-factor authentication (2FA), have been implemented.
Illumina, Inc.
- Technological Leap: In January 2025, the NovaSeq X Plus platform, offering high-throughput, cost-effective sequencing tailored for large-scale genomic and paternity testing.
MyHeritage Ltd.
- Geographic Expansion: Acquired Gene by Gene in March 2025, significantly enhancing its U.S. presence.
- Ethnicity Update Rollout: Starting in early 2025, the company launched Ethnicity Estimate v2.5, featuring a "third pillar" improvement across its database, confirmed to be released before March 6, 2025.
